1. Understand Your Business Goals
Before searching for an agency, define what success means for your brand. Are you focused on increasing engagement, driving sales, or building brand awareness? Knowing this will guide your search and ensure you select an agency that aligns with your objectives.
For example, a luxury resort in Las Vegas might aim to attract high-end tourists through visually striking Instagram campaigns, while a local restaurant might focus on TikTok promotions and influencer collaborations. Start by outlining SMART goals—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ound—to create a clear roadmap for your marketing efforts.
Execution steps:
- Identify your primary objectives (e.g., sales growth, traffic increase).
- Determine which platforms align best with those goals.
- Set measurable KPIs, such as click-through rates or engagement percentages.
2. Evaluate Experience and Expertise
Not all agencies are created equal. Look for an agency with a proven track record in your industry and specific experience managing campaigns in Las Vegas. Agencies familiar with the city’s unique entertainment-driven culture can craft more authentic and effective campaigns.
For instance, an agency experienced in hospitality marketing will know how to target tourists through geo-specific ads or influencer partnerships. Reviewing client portfolios, testimonials, and case studies is key to assessing their competence.
Execution steps:
- Request case studies showing ROI improvements.
- Ask about niche experience (hospitality, retail, nightlife, etc.).
- Evaluate their understanding of current platform algorithms.
3. Assess Strategy and Creativity
A great agency doesn’t just manage accounts—it develops creative strategies that resonate with audiences. The best campaigns often merge storytelling with analytics, producing content that’s both emotionally engaging and data-backed.
For example, a Las Vegas entertainment brand might leverage behind-the-scenes content on Instagram Stories, while a tech startup could use LinkedIn thought leadership posts to attract investors. Agencies that rely solely on paid ads without organic strategy often deliver short-term results but miss long-term brand loyalty.
Execution steps:
- Ask for a creative pitch or campaign concept before signing.
- Evaluate their approach to organic vs. paid strategy balance.
- Check whether they use A/B testing for creative optimization.
4. Check Tools and Technology
In 2026, AI-driven analytics and automation tools have become central to social media management. Your digital marketing agency should utilize platforms for performance tracking, sentiment analysis, and predictive targeting. Agencies using outdated manual methods are unlikely to provide actionable insights.
For example, advanced tools like Sprout Social or Hootsuite Insights help analyze competitor strategies, while AI platforms can suggest the best posting times for your audience.
Execution steps:
- Ask what analytics platforms the agency uses.
- Request monthly data reports and dashboards.
- Ensure tools integrate with your CRM or eCommerce platform.
5. Transparency and Communication
Transparency is a hallmark of a trustworthy agency. Clear reporting, honest feedback, and consistent updates foster better collaboration. Beware of agencies that provide vague data or avoid discussing underperforming metrics.
For instance, a transparent agency will regularly share campaign performance reports, even when results fall short, and propose data-driven improvements.
Execution steps:
- Set expectations for biweekly or monthly reporting.
- Discuss preferred communication channels (email, Slack, Zoom).
- Review sample reports for detail and clarity.
6. Budget and Pricing Models
While cost shouldn’t be the sole deciding factor, understanding pricing models helps avoid surprises later. Some agencies charge flat monthly retainers, while others work on performance-based models tied to results.
For example, a boutique Las Vegas agency may offer flexible pricing for startups, while larger firms might have minimum spend thresholds. Compare options and ensure the pricing aligns with both your budget and expected ROI.
Execution steps:
- Request detailed proposals with pricing breakdowns.
- Ask about contract terms and cancellation policies.
- Evaluate ROI projections before committing.
7. Cultural Fit and Long-Term Vision
Your agency should feel like an extension of your team. Cultural compatibility often determines how smoothly collaboration goes. Choose a partner that shares your brand’s values, communication style, and vision for growth.
For example, a fast-moving nightlife brand might prefer a bold, trend-driven agency, while a financial firm might need a more data-focused, conservative approach. Building a long-term relationship ensures consistent brand voice and evolving strategies.
Execution steps:
- Conduct discovery meetings with key team members.
- Review how they handle creative approvals and feedback loops.
- Establish long-term KPIs to track progress over time.
8. Final Evaluation and Decision
After shortlisting agencies, conduct side-by-side comparisons using a weighted scoring system. Rate each on experience, creativity, communication, and price. Consider running a short pilot campaign to test their execution ability before a long-term contract.
